Why This Backpack Works for Day-to-Night Styling


Most backpacks read as purely casual, but the Louis Vuitton Multipocket Backpack has a refined edge. The coated canvas gives it a subtle sheen that catches evening light, while the multiple front pockets add a utilitarian touch that pairs well with both tailored and relaxed outfits. Its compact dimensions — 30 x 22 x 12 cm — keep the silhouette neat, so it doesn’t overwhelm a dress or a blazer.
What sets this piece apart is its versatility: the adjustable shoulder straps let you switch from a snug backpack carry to a more relaxed slouch, changing the entire vibe. For day, wear it high and close; for evening, loosen the straps and let it hang lower for an effortlessly chic look.

Practical Styling Tips: What to Pack and How to Wear It
To make the most of this backpack’s design, use the exterior pockets strategically. The front zip pocket is ideal for valuables like your phone and wallet, while the slip pockets can hold a reusable water bottle or a small umbrella. The main compartment is spacious enough for a 15-inch laptop, a thin sweater, and a makeup pouch.
When packing, roll your clothes to save space and keep heavier items at the bottom. The backpack’s 30 x 22 x 12 cm dimensions are compact enough to fit under an airplane seat, making it a great personal item for travel — just check your airline’s size limits. For a day trip, pack a light jacket, a book, and a snack; the multiple pockets keep everything organized.
To wear it comfortably all day, adjust the straps so the backpack sits high on your back — this distributes weight evenly and prevents strain. For a more relaxed look, loosen the straps and let it hang lower, but be mindful of your posture if you’re carrying a laptop.

How do I clean the coated canvas?
Use a soft, slightly damp cloth to wipe the coated canvas. Avoid harsh chemicals or soaking the bag. For stubborn marks, a mild soap solution on a cloth works, but test on a small area first. Never machine wash or dry clean. Store the backpack in its dust bag when not in use to prevent scratches.
